Product Development: Key Considerations for Long-Lasting Car Solid Air Fresheners

The key to success in this market lies in offering high-quality, long-lasting products that cater to diverse consumer preferences. Several crucial aspects need careful consideration:

1. Fragrance Selection: Choosing the right fragrance is paramount. Market research is crucial to identify popular scents in different target markets. While classic scents like lavender and vanilla remain popular, trending notes like sandalwood, amber, and citrus blends should also be considered. It's important to offer a diverse range to appeal to a broader customer base. Furthermore, understanding cultural nuances in fragrance preferences across different countries is vital for successful export. For instance, some cultures may have strong preferences for certain floral or woody scents, while others might prefer lighter, fresher fragrances.

2. Material Selection: The base material significantly impacts the longevity and efficacy of the fragrance release. Common materials include natural clays, porous stones, or specially engineered polymers. Each material offers unique properties regarding fragrance absorption, diffusion rate, and overall lifespan. The choice depends on the desired fragrance intensity and longevity. Sustainable and eco-friendly materials are increasingly in demand, so exploring options like biodegradable clays or recycled polymers is advantageous.

3. Fragrance Oil Quality: Using high-quality fragrance oils is non-negotiable. Cheap, low-quality oils can result in a weak, unpleasant scent, or even off-gassing of harmful chemicals. Chinese exporters should prioritize sourcing fragrance oils from reputable suppliers who adhere to international safety and quality standards. Compliance with regulations like REACH (in Europe) and other regional standards is crucial for smooth international trade.

4. Design and Aesthetics: The visual appeal of the solid air freshener is crucial for attracting customers. Creative designs, attractive packaging, and appealing color choices can significantly influence sales. Consider incorporating elements that reflect the target market's cultural preferences or current design trends. Miniature or uniquely shaped products can also add to the appeal, particularly for gifting.

5. Longevity and Efficacy: The claim of "long-lasting" must be substantiated. Thorough testing is necessary to determine the actual fragrance lifespan under different conditions (temperature, humidity, ventilation). Providing clear and accurate information about the expected duration of fragrance release is crucial for building consumer trust and avoiding potential disputes.

Marketing and International Trade:

Successfully exporting long-lasting car solid air fresheners requires a well-defined marketing strategy and understanding of international trade regulations.

1. Market Research: Thorough market research is crucial to identify potential buyers and understand their preferences. Understanding regional differences in consumer demands is vital for tailoring products and marketing materials accordingly. This includes analyzing competitor products, pricing strategies, and distribution channels.

2. Branding and Packaging: A strong brand identity is crucial for establishing trust and recognition in international markets. The packaging should be attractive, informative, and compliant with relevant regulations (labeling requirements, safety warnings, etc.). Multilingual packaging is essential for reaching a wider audience.

3. Online Marketplaces: Leveraging online marketplaces like Alibaba, Amazon, and eBay can significantly expand reach and access global customers. Optimizing product listings with relevant keywords and high-quality images is vital for attracting potential buyers.

4. Trade Shows and Exhibitions: Participating in international trade shows and exhibitions provides opportunities to network with potential buyers, showcase products, and gather market insights. This direct interaction is valuable for establishing business relationships and securing orders.

5. Compliance and Regulations: Chinese exporters must ensure their products comply with all relevant safety and environmental regulations in the target markets. This includes understanding and adhering to standards regarding fragrance oil composition, packaging materials, and labeling requirements. Failure to comply can lead to product recalls, fines, and damage to brand reputation.

6. Logistics and Shipping: Efficient and reliable logistics are crucial for timely delivery and customer satisfaction. Choosing reputable shipping partners and ensuring proper packaging to prevent damage during transit is essential.
